#b593c4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b593c4 is composed of 71% red, 57.6% green and 76.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 7.7% cyan, 25% magenta, 0% yellow and 23.1% black. It has a hue angle of 281.6 degrees, a saturation of 29.3% and a lightness of 67.3%. #b593c4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6b2789.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

Shades and Tints of #b593c4
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050306 is the darkest color, while #fbf8f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#b593c4
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#aea6b1 is the less saturated color, while #cb59fe is the most saturated one.
